In its editorial on March 19, the paper states that denuclearisation efforts will fail as long as sanctions on North Korea remain porous.

SEOUL (THE KOREA HERALD/ ASIA NEWS NETWORK) - The United States and China remain apart on solutions to North Korean nuclear threats.

US Secretary of State Rex Tillerson and his Chinese counterpart Wang Yi agreed in their meeting on Saturday to work together to stop North Korea from developing nuclear weapons. But they repeated their different positions on solutions.

The US demanded China put stronger pressure on North Korea, while China reiterated its call for both dialogue and negotiations.

A day earlier, Tillerson had said on his visit to Seoul that Washington would not talk with Pyongyang unless it denuclearises and abandons its weapons of mass destruction.

He said the US policy of strategic patience has ended and that it was time to pressure the North, not talk with it. The top US diplomat said 20 years of efforts to denuclearise the North had failed.

According to CNN, the communist state is preparing to test an international ballistic missile that could hit the mainland US. Recent satellite images revealed it was digging a tunnel apparently for an atomic bomb test.

Why efforts to denuclearise North Korea have failed needs to be reviewed.

First, North Korea has no intention to give up its nuclear and missile programme.

Even as it attended six-party talks, the communist state ran a reactor suspected of having produced nuclear weapon materials and conducted a nuclear test.

Now, its leader Kim Jong-un says bluntly it would continue to develop nuclear weapons and ballistic missiles at any cost.

As it nears the ability to deploy nuclear missiles, the North will see no reason to attend any negotiations aimed at making it scrap its nukes.

Secondly, sanctions on North Korea were porous.

China has often opened a back door by which North Korea could avoid punishments.

According to a Voice of America report, 10 North Korean ships entered the port of Longkou in China's eastern Shandong province Thursday after having stayed in international waters for the past three weeks.

It was not clear what they were carrying, but the port had previously been used by North Korean ships to unload coal. The ships appeared to have been held from the port following Beijing's ban on imports of North Korean coal until the end of this year.

A 2016 UN Security Council report said North Korea had traded weapons and other banned items through China-based firms with ties to the North. The report cites dozens of the North's violations, which appeared to be connected with China.

Opening a side door is an act of fooling the international community. China should stop gesturing at slapping on sanctions.

As long as a side door is open, efforts to denuclearise North Korea cannot but fail.

The international community began to tighten its sanctions on the North. Swift, the inter-bank money transfer system, recently cut off the last North Korean banks on the network.

According to news reports, the issue of a US missile shield being deployed in Korea was rarely mentioned in the news conference after talks between Tillerson and Wang.

Wang expressed China's position on the Terminal High Altitude Area Defence system, while Tillerson never uttered mention of Thaad.

It's unclear whether they discussed the matter before the news conference, but it is regrettable the US diplomat did not mention it at the news conference.

Tillerson urged China to refrain from pressure on Korea over the deployment of the system Friday.

Thaad is being installed to fend off nuclear missiles from North Korea, not to spy on China as it argues. Without nukes in the North, the South would have no reason to host the system.

The North should heed the warnings from the tougher US, which is readying punishment with all possible means if its threats cross the red line. Washington is reportedly weighing a pre-emptive strike as an option.

Pyongyang should remember that the US government is resolute against it having nukes, and that if it crosses the red line, it may see the end of its regime.

The Korea Herald is a member of The Straits Times media partner Asia News Network, an alliance of 22 news media entities.

中国将不参加今年“禁止核武器条约”谈判
2017年03月20日16:02 环球网

  原标题:中国将不参加今年“禁止核武器条约”谈判
资料图。资料图。

  [环球时报-环球网报道 记者 郭芳] 据了解,根据去年联大相关决议,“禁止核武器条约”谈判会议即将于3月27日在纽约举行。中国去年对该决议投了弃权票。现谈判会议临近,中国是否决定参加?在20日的例行记者会上,中国外交部发言人华春莹在回答《环球时报》记者有关此事的提问时说,近期中方一直就“条约”谈判相关问题同有关方保持着坦诚、深入沟通。经慎重研究,中方日前决定不参加谈判。

  华春莹说,中国一惯主张并积极倡导最终全面禁止和彻底销毁核武器,这与“禁止核武器条约”谈判宗旨在根本上是一致的。同时,中方也认为,实现核裁军目标无法一蹴而就,必须遵循“维护全球战略稳定”和“各国安全不受减损”的原则,循序渐进地加以推进。相关进程必须在现有国际裁军和防扩散机制下处理。

  华春莹说,中方这一决定系出于维护现有国际军控和裁军机制以及坚持循序渐进推进核裁军原则的考虑,体现了中方对维护全球战略平衡与稳定的负责任态度。

  “尽管不参与谈判,中方坚定支持最终全面禁止和彻底销毁核武器的立场没有改变”,华春莹表示,中方愿与各方保持沟通,继续为建立无核武器世界共同努力。
